A Brief Slice of Little Caesars History
Before we dive into the juicy stuff, let's take a quick trip down memory lane. Little Caesars Pizza was founded in 1959 by Mike and Marian Ilitch in Garden City, Michigan. They introduced the world to their signature HOT-N-READY concept, where pizzas are always ready and waiting, no need to call ahead or wait for delivery. Today, Little Caesars has grown into a global pizza powerhouse, with over 4,500 locations across the United States and 25 countries worldwide.
Little Caesars' Annual Revenue: A Big Slice of the Pie
Now, let's get to the main course – how much money does Little Caesars make in a year? According to the latest available data, Little Caesars' annual revenue hovers around the $4 billion mark. Yes, you heard it right – that's a whole lot of pizza!
Here's a breakdown of their earnings over the past few years:
- 2019: Little Caesars' annual revenue reached an all-time high of $4.2 billion. - 2018: The company generated around $4 billion in annual sales. - 2017: Little Caesars' annual revenue was approximately $3.8 billion.
What Drives Little Caesars' Success?
Little Caesars' annual earnings are a testament to their unique business model and marketing strategies. Here are a few factors that contribute to their success:
Affordable Pricing
Little Caesars is famous for its value pricing, with pizzas starting at just $5. Their HOT-N-READY concept allows customers to grab a pizza on the go without the wait or the delivery fee. This combination of affordability and convenience keeps customers coming back for more.
Marketing Mastery
Little Caesars has a knack for creating memorable marketing campaigns. From their iconic "Pizza! Pizza!" ads to their Super Bowl commercials and sponsorships, the company knows how to grab attention and entice customers.
Global Expansion
Little Caesars has expanded its reach beyond the United States, with locations in countries like Canada, Australia, and the Middle East. This global presence contributes significantly to their annual revenue.

Little Caesars' Community Involvement
While we've been focusing on the money side of things, it's essential to mention that Little Caesars is also committed to giving back to the community. The company supports various charitable causes through its Little Caesars Love Kitchen, which provides free pizza to those in need. They also partner with organizations like Habitat for Humanity and Gleaners Community Food Bank to make a positive impact.
